We are a dynamic multifunctional team delivering structural repairs and repair processes to support the fleet. We work closely together to provide complex repairs in support of planned major repair activities and wing major test programmes, as well as developing pre-defined repair solutions to support Daily Repair turnaround times. We enjoy the challenge of creating and delivering repairs for any sort of damage, anywhere on the wing!
ABOUT THE ROLE
Working as part of a multiskilled team you will be responsible for completing Fatigue & Damage Tolerance analysis and justifications for metallic and composite structures. Your primary role will be to work closely with Design and Static Stress engineers to assess and validate repairs to damaged aircraft structures. Additional tasks may include managing the offload of packages of work to suppliers, presenting major repair scoping to senior stakeholders, and guiding and supporting sub-contract suppliers providing structural analysis work. You will ensure adherence to airworthiness regulations, relevant design principles, processes, methods and manufacturing capabilities guidelines. The role provides an excellent development opportunity by exposing to complex In-service issues and continued airworthiness process.
HOW YOU WILL CONTRIBUTE TO THE TEAM
- Performing F&DT analysis and compiling justification reports for repair designs using approved methods and tools, working closely with skilled Design and Static Stress engineers to develop optimum repairs.
- Providing technical guidance and support to the internal teams, including the offshore teams, and any suppliers as required.
- Where necessary, leading packages of work, and integrating with Design and Static Stress teams for a major incident or complex activities.
- Developing methods and processes for repair analysis, working with method experts and tool owners to enhance the analysis capability of the repair teams.
- As well as working with the NDT specialist, developing inspection processes for repaired aircraft.
- When required, providing support to the repair team on other structure perimeters such as Fuselage, Empennage, High-Lift devices, etc.
